引言
继电器作为一种重要的电气控制元件,广泛应用于工业自动化、家用电器、通信等领域。了解继电器的输出类型对于正确选择和使用继电器至关重要。本文将详细介绍继电器的几种常见输出类型,帮助读者掌握关键,选择无忧。
一、继电器输出类型概述
继电器的输出类型主要分为以下几种:
- 直流输出(DC)
- 交流输出(AC)
- 交流和直流混合输出
- 无触点输出
二、直流输出(DC)
直流输出继电器是最常见的继电器类型之一,广泛应用于电子设备、工业控制等领域。其特点是:
- 输出电压和电流为直流电,通常有12V、24V、48V等不同规格。
- 结构简单,响应速度快,可靠性高。
- 适用于控制直流负载,如直流电机、直流电源等。
举例说明
以下是一个直流输出继电器的应用实例:
# 直流输出继电器控制直流电机
import RPi.GPIO as GPIO
import time
# 设置GPIO引脚
IN1 = 17
IN2 = 27
# 设置GPIO模式
GPIO.setmode(GPIO.BCM)
# 设置GPIO引脚为输出模式
GPIO.setup(IN1, GPIO.OUT)
GPIO.setup(IN2, GPIO.OUT)
# 控制直流电机正转
GPIO.output(IN1, GPIO.HIGH)
GPIO.output(IN2, GPIO.LOW)
time.sleep(2)
# 控制直流电机反转
GPIO.output(IN1, GPIO.LOW)
GPIO.output(IN2, GPIO.HIGH)
time.sleep(2)
# 关闭GPIO引脚
GPIO.cleanup()
三、交流输出(AC)
交流输出继电器主要用于控制交流负载,如交流电机、交流电源等。其特点是:
- 输出电压和电流为交流电,通常有220V、380V等不同规格。
- 结构复杂,响应速度较慢,可靠性相对较低。
- 适用于控制交流负载。
举例说明
以下是一个交流输出继电器的应用实例:
# 交流输出继电器控制交流电机
import RPi.GPIO as GPIO
import time
# 设置GPIO引脚
IN1 = 17
IN2 = 27
# 设置GPIO模式
GPIO.setmode(GPIO.BCM)
# 设置GPIO引脚为输出模式
GPIO.setup(IN1, GPIO.OUT)
GPIO.setup(IN2, GPIO.OUT)
# 控制交流电机正转
GPIO.output(IN1, GPIO.HIGH)
GPIO.output(IN2, GPIO.LOW)
time.sleep(2)
# 控制交流电机反转
GPIO.output(IN1, GPIO.LOW)
GPIO.output(IN2, GPIO.HIGH)
time.sleep(2)
# 关闭GPIO引脚
GPIO.cleanup()
四、交流和直流混合输出
交流和直流混合输出继电器可以同时控制交流和直流负载。其特点是:
- 输出电压和电流既可以是交流电,也可以是直流电。
- 结构复杂,响应速度较慢,可靠性相对较低。
- 适用于同时控制交流和直流负载。
举例说明
以下是一个交流和直流混合输出继电器的应用实例:
# 交流和直流混合输出继电器控制交流电机和直流电机
import RPi.GPIO as GPIO
import time
# 设置GPIO引脚
IN1 = 17
IN2 = 27
IN3 = 22
IN4 = 23
# 设置GPIO模式
GPIO.setmode(GPIO.BCM)
# 设置GPIO引脚为输出模式
GPIO.setup(IN1, GPIO.OUT)
GPIO.setup(IN2, GPIO.OUT)
GPIO.setup(IN3, GPIO.OUT)
GPIO.setup(IN4, GPIO.OUT)
# 控制交流电机正转
GPIO.output(IN1, GPIO.HIGH)
GPIO.output(IN2, GPIO.LOW)
time.sleep(2)
# 控制直流电机正转
GPIO.output(IN3, GPIO.HIGH)
GPIO.output(IN4, GPIO.LOW)
time.sleep(2)
# 关闭GPIO引脚
GPIO.cleanup()
五、无触点输出
无触点输出继电器是一种新型继电器,其特点是:
- 无机械触点,使用寿命长,可靠性高。
- 输出电压和电流为直流电,通常有5V、12V、24V等不同规格。
- 适用于控制低电压、小电流负载。
举例说明
以下是一个无触点输出继电器的应用实例:
# 无触点输出继电器控制LED灯
import RPi.GPIO as GPIO
import time
# 设置GPIO引脚
LED_PIN = 17
# 设置GPIO模式
GPIO.setmode(GPIO.BCM)
# 设置GPIO引脚为输出模式
GPIO.setup(LED_PIN, GPIO.OUT)
# 控制LED灯点亮
GPIO.output(LED_PIN, GPIO.HIGH)
time.sleep(2)
# 控制LED灯熄灭
GPIO.output(LED_PIN, GPIO.LOW)
time.sleep(2)
# 关闭GPIO引脚
GPIO.cleanup()
六、总结
本文详细介绍了继电器的几种常见输出类型,包括直流输出、交流输出、交流和直流混合输出以及无触点输出。通过对这些输出类型的了解,读者可以更好地选择和使用继电器,为电气控制项目提供有力保障。
